F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
|
Herramientas | Buscar en Tema | Desplegado |
#1
|
|||
|
|||
Relacion Muhcos a muchos
Pues esta en m duda:
Tengo 3 tablas, la A y C principales y la B intermedia con las claves primarias de las principales, lo que viene a ser una relacion de muchos a muchos. Pues bien lo que quiero conseguir es que segun la fila que seleccione en A me aparezcan las que estan relacionadas con ella de C. Cosigo hacer la primera relacion (1 a muchos de A a B) pero me atasco en lo siguiente?? Gracias |
#2
|
||||
|
||||
Creo que esto deberia funcionar:
SELECT C.* FORM C INNER JOIN B ON(C.ID_C=B.ID_C) INNER JOIN A ON(B.ID_A=A.ID_A) WHERE A.ID_A=:P Esta consulta recibe como parametro (P) el ID de A y te devuelve todas las entradas en C que esten relacionadas con A en la tabla B. La tabla B tiene que tener algo asi: ID_C; ID_A; ... Un saludo.
__________________
Intentando hacer algo con Delphi 7 y Firebird 1.5 |
|
|
Temas Similares | ||||
Tema | Autor | Foro | Respuestas | Último mensaje |
Muchos carcteres en una línea | mastercad | Gráficos | 0 | 15-07-2005 04:06:08 |
UPDATE en una relacion 1 a Muchos... | JorgeBec | SQL | 4 | 19-11-2004 20:16:37 |
... muchos requisitos ... | Jure | Humor | 0 | 02-04-2004 16:22:18 |
Imprimir muchos documentos | cisterpe | Impresión | 0 | 28-02-2004 23:51:06 |
Consulta SQl, relacion 1 a muchos | Walter | SQL | 3 | 15-07-2003 03:13:28 |
|